There is a memory leak when we call 'device_list_properties' with typename =
stm32f2xx_timer. It's easy to reproduce as follow:
virsh qemu-monitor-command vm1 --pretty '{"execute": "device-list-properties", "arguments":
{"typename": "stm32f2xx_timer"}}'
This patch delay timer_new to fix this memleaks.
